Complex Adaptive Innovation SystemsRelatedness and Transversality in the Evolving Region\nAuthor(s): Philip Cooke\nFormat: Paperback\nPublisher: Taylor & Francis Ltd, United Kingdom\nImprint: Routledge\nISBN-13: 9781138792135, 978-1138792135\nSynopsis\nLeading up to the financial crisis of 2008 and onwards, the shortcomings of traditional models of regional economic and environmental development had become increasingly evident. Rooted in the idea that policy is an encumbrance to free markets, the stress on supply-side smoothing measures such as clusters and an over reliance on venture capital, the inadequacy of existing orthodoxies has come to be replaced by the notion of transversality.\n\nThis approach has three strong characteristics that differentiate it from its failing predecessor.
